Sophisticated Techniques in Forensic Investigation

Forensic investigations have evolved significantly over the years, incorporating cutting-edge techniques to scrutinize evidence more effectively. Among these advancements are:

* Digital Forensics: This specialized field focuses on recovering data from electronic devices like smartphones, often essential in cybercrime investigations.

* Forensic DNA Analysis: With ever-increasing precision, DNA profiling can now link suspects to crime scenes with remarkable certainty.

* Trace Evidence Analysis: Microscopes and other tools are used to examine minute traces of evidence like glass fragments, often providing significant clues in complex investigations.

These advanced techniques, coupled with the expertise of skilled forensic scientists, play a essential role in solving criminal cases and seeking justice.

Peek into World of a Digital Forensic Analyst

A digital forensic analyst undertakes a clandestine mission within the realm of cyberspace. Their toolkit consists of specialized software and technical prowess, employed to excavate crucial digital evidence from systems. These meticulously scrutinize data remnants, like emails, deleted files, and internet history, to uncover the facts behind cybercrimes.

The analyst's role requires meticulous attention to detail and a sharp mind. They must be able to decipher complex technical data, construct a coherent narrative, and present their findings in a clear manner.

  • Additionally, digital forensic analysts often testify to share their expertise with legal professionals.
  • Ultimately, this challenging profession plays a crucial role in the fight against cybercrime, safeguarding individuals and organizations from the devastating consequences of online maliciousness.
